HYDRAULIC REVERSE STRESS APPARATUS.
I am sorry to say that this scheme, as shewn on prints J.4902. and J.4926., does not promise to be worth its cost.
We must tackle the job somehow differently, or abandon it altogether.
R.{Sir Henry Royce}
